Saved Shipments

Introduction

The Saved Shipments page allows you to view and manage shipments that were created and saved directly in the SmartConsign Web Portal, but have not yet been assigned to a carrier.

A saved shipment is an unallocated shipment record. Its details have been saved in SmartConsign, but no shipping label has been generated.

Use this page to search for saved shipments, review their details, correct or complete missing information, create the carrier shipment, or delete records that are no longer required.

ℹ️ External-channel orders:
Orders received from Shopify, wooCommerce, eBay, or other connected channels are not displayed on the Saved Shipments page. Manage these orders from Marketplaces → Manage Orders.


What Is a Saved Shipment?

A Saved Shipment is a shipment that was created and saved directly in the SmartConsign Web Portal but has not yet been processed with a carrier.

This means:

  • No carrier service has been assigned.
  • No carrier shipment has been created.
  • No shipping label has been generated.
  • No label can be printed or downloaded.
  • There is no carrier shipment to cancel.
  • The shipment details must be reviewed and completed before the shipment can be created.

A shipment may appear on this page when:

  • It was saved from the Create a Shipment page.
  • A carrier or service has not yet been selected.
  • The shipment needs to be reviewed before it is created with a carrier.

ℹ️ Note:
Orders imported from external channels do not become Saved Shipments. They are managed from Marketplaces → Manage Orders.

Edit a Saved Shipment

Use Edit ✏️ when a saved shipment needs to be reviewed, corrected, or completed before it can be created with a carrier.

Step-by-step

  1. Find the saved shipment in the table.
  2. Click the menu icon ☰ on the right-hand side of the row.
  3. Select Edit ✏️.
  4. Review the shipment details.
  5. Update any missing or incorrect information.
  6. Select the required carrier and service.
  7. Review the parcel information.
  8. Create the shipment when it is ready to be processed.

Best Practice:
Before creating the shipment, check the delivery address, shipper, carrier service, parcel weight, dimensions, and any carrier-specific information.

When a Saved Shipment Becomes a Shipment

A saved shipment becomes a carrier shipment when all required information has been completed and the shipment is successfully created with a carrier service.

Before creating the shipment, make sure:

  • The delivery address is complete and valid.
  • The correct shipper is selected.
  • The shipment reference is correct.
  • Parcel weight and dimensions are entered.
  • Shipment value is entered, where required.
  • The correct carrier and service are selected.
  • Any required customs information is complete, where applicable.
  • Any carrier-specific required fields are complete.

After the shipment has been created with a carrier:

  • A carrier shipment record is created.
  • A shipping label may be generated.
  • The shipment enters the standard shipment workflow.
  • The record can be managed from Manage Shipments or the relevant shipment status page.

Common Issues

I cannot find a saved shipment

Check that:

  • The correct Shipper is selected.
  • The correct date range is selected.
  • The shipment reference or search text is entered correctly.
  • The record has not already been created with a carrier.
  • The record was created directly in the SmartConsign Web UI.

For orders received from Shopify, wooCommerce, eBay, or another connected channel, go to Marketplaces → Manage Orders.

A saved shipment has no label

This is expected. A saved shipment has not yet been created with a carrier service.

Open the saved shipment, complete the required details, select a carrier service, and create the shipment before attempting to print or download a label.

I cannot print or download labels

Saved Shipments cannot have labels printed or downloaded because no carrier shipment or label exists yet.

Complete the saved shipment and create it with a carrier first.

I cannot cancel the shipment with the carrier

A Saved Shipment has not been created with a carrier, so there is no carrier shipment to cancel.

When the saved record is no longer required, use Delete 🗑️ instead.
